Election Results, U.S. Representative from Ohio, 10th District
Voters in Ohio , as in other U.S. states elect a certain number of representatives to the United States House of Representatives . The following chart shows the results of the elections for the 10th congressional district of Ohio. Bold type indicates victor. Italic type indicates incumbent.

Year Democratic Republican Other
2004 Dennis J. Kucinich : 167,221 Edward F. Herman : 94,120 Barbara Ferris: 17,753
2002 Dennis J. Kucinich : 129,997 Jon A. Heben : 41,778 Judy Locy: 3,761
2000 Dennis J. Kucinich : 167,063 Bill Smith : 48,930 Ron Petrie (L ): 6,762
1998 Dennis J. Kucinich : 110,552 Joe Slovenec : 55,015
1996 Dennis J. Kucinich : 110,723 Martin R. Hoke : 104,546 Robert B. Iverson (N ): 10,415
1994 Francis E. Gaul : 70,918 Martin R. Hoke : 95,226 Joseph J. Jacobs Jr. : 17,495
1992 Mary Rose Oakar *: 103,788 Martin R. Hoke : 136,433
1990 John M. Buchanan : 61,656 Clarence E. Miller *: 106,009
1988 John M. Buchanan : 56,893 Clarence E. Miller : 143,673
1986 John M. Buchanan : 44,847 Clarence E. Miller : 106,870
1984 John M. Buchanan : 55,172 Clarence E. Miller : 149,337
1982 John M. Buchanan : 57,983 Clarence E. Miller : 100,044
1980 Jack E. Stecher : 49,433 Clarence E. Miller : 143,403
1978 James A. Plummer : 35,039 Clarence E. Miller : 99,329
1976 James A. Plummer : 57,757 Clarence E. Miller : 127,147
1974 H. Kent Bumpass : 42,333 Clarence E. Miller : 100,521
1972 Robert H. Whealey : 47,456 Clarence E. Miller : 129,683
1970 Doug Arnett : 40,669 Clarence E. Miller : 80,838
1968 Harry B. Crewson : 45,686 Clarence E. Miller : 102,890
1966 Walter H. Moeller : 52,258 Clarence E. Miller : 56,659
1964 Walter H. Moeller : 54,729 Homer E. "Pete" Abele : 49,744
1962 Walter H. Moeller : 42,131 Homer E. "Pete" Abele : 46,158
1960 Walter H. Moeller : 58,085 Oakley C. Collins : 52,479
1958 Walter H. Moeller : 47,939 Homer E. "Pete" Abele : 42,607
1956 Thomas A. Jenkins : 71,295
1954 Truman A. Morris : 28,150 Thomas A. Jenkins : 45,277
1952 Delmar A. Canaday : 35,666 Thomas A. Jenkins : 63,339
1950 Wiliam J. Curry : 21,117 Thomas A. Jenkins : 39,584
1948 Delmar A. Canaday : 27,913 Thomas A. Jenkins : 38,330
1946 H. A. McCown : 17,719 Thomas A. Jenkins : 35,406
1944 Elsie Stanton : 23,986 Thomas A. Jenkins : 43,388
1942 Oral Daugherty : 16,582 Thomas A. Jenkins : 29,691
1940 John P. Kelso : 33,698 Thomas A. Jenkins : 48,217
1938 Elsie Stanton : 24,198 Thomas A. Jenkins : 47,036
1936 O. J. Kleffner : 34,477 Thomas A. Jenkins : 46,965
1934 W. F. Marting : 26,278 Thomas A. Jenkins : 36,824
1932 Charles M. Hogan : 29,027 Thomas A. Jenkins : 41,654
1930 H. L. Crary : 19,157 Thomas A. Jenkins : 31,836
1928 Charles E. Poston : 16,551 Thomas A. Jenkins : 38,347
1926 Guy Stevenson : 14,460 Thomas A. Jenkins : 25,571
1924 W. F. Rutherford : 17,923 Thomas A. Jenkins : 32,617
1922 James Sharp : 17,811 Israel M. Foster : 30,341
1920 Benjamin F. Reynolds : 21,429 Israel M. Foster : 38,436
After the redistricting following the 1990 census , Miller was moved to the sixth district . He was defeated in the 1992 Republican primary by fellow Republican incumbent Robert D. McEwen . Also, incumbent Democrat Oakar was moved into the 10th district from the 20th district , which was eliminated in the redistricting.
